Responsibilities

  • Based on needs and priority – analyze, plan and assist Dealer management staff in Parts and Service business matters including operational analysis, staffing, and staff capability
  • Follow up to ensure that Dealers have implemented and maintain key programs, including but not limited to Toyota Service Management (TSM), and Total Quality Management (TQM)
  • Liaise between the Parts Distribution Centre (PDC) and the Dealerships on policy issues that require clarification
  • Support the introduction and continuation of initiatives managed through diverse Fixed Operations departments at Toyota Canada
  • Lead Dealer management staff in focusing on long term Service Retention plans and explore areas of opportunity to increase capacity/maximize opportunities for success
  • Monitor objectives and achievement of Service and Accessory Parts sales
  • Develop Dealer processes for building Parts sales within the Service department
  • Assist Dealer departments in developing Marketing plans to increase Accessory visibility across the establishment or online
  • Help design pay plan, processes, and training to maximize Accessory sales
  • Assist, where necessary, to ensure the Dealers develop and maintain an effective After-Sales Marketing strategy which is complementary to National and Zone Marketing initiatives
  • U.I.O. analysis to determine market potential and related Sales and Retention targets
  • Effective use of Marketing and merchandising programs
  • Use of event Marketing such as service clinics and second delivery nights
  • Ensure adequate Customer follow-up and Retention systems are in place and properly utilized
  • Promotion of vehicle customization and Accessory sales (ADM)
  • Monitor Dealer receivables to ensure that claim administration is current
  • Administer warranty labour rate applications to ensure the warranty and Extra Care Protection (ECP) reimbursement rates are current
  • Enlist the assistance of and support the Field Warranty consultant to address claim administration problems and training needs
  • Encourage the sale of ECP as a Customer satisfaction and Retention Tool.
  • Identify Customer Satisfaction issues which are the result of Dealer Process, policies facility and staffing. Enlist the assistance of and supports the Field Customer Relations Consultant in addressing these issues
  • During regular Dealer contacts, monitor housekeeping activities and the use of corporate image materials. Ensure After-Sales facilities and personnel portray a professional image as identified by the Dealer Image and Operating Standards
  • Ensure that the Dealerships attend technical training, and that they meet the TECSMART training standard
  • Maintain TCI/Dealership training records
  • Encourage the regular submission of technical reports (Dealer product reports)
  • Enlist the assistance of and supports the Field Technical consultant to ensure that the Dealer service equipment meets the TCI standards and overall Dealer technical capability meets TCI standards
